Funda joined ATÖLYE in 2020 as a Senior Visual Communications Designer. Her role focuses on complementing and enriching ATÖLYE’s communications efforts through visual storytelling both in print and digital mediums. She has been involved in a variety of projects ranging from designing the identity and visual narrative of kyu Graph to crafting ATÖLYE Academy’s colorful brand. 


Funda is a versatile designer with over 10 years of experience in branding, communication design and advertising. She started her career in Edinburgh as an independent designer working with a variety of SMEs, arts festivals, higher education institutions, charities and UK-based research centers. Upon her return to Turkey she joined BrandSeers, an Istanbul-based brand consultancy serving local and international clients in strategy, trend analysis and design. Prior to ATÖLYE she was an art director at independent advertising agency Modiki providing online and offline communications solutions to Turkey’s leading brands. 

Funda completed her undergraduate degree at Bilkent University’s Department of Graphic Design and then went on to obtain an MFA from the Edinburgh College of Art in the United Kingdom. Her master’s thesis focused on narrative and its role in enriching the design process, which continues to inform her practice.

 

Outside of work, Funda loves printmaking and regularly dreams about setting up a small screen printing studio. She’s happiest out in the fresh air where you can find her hiking, trail running or negotiating the winds as a newbie sailor.
